411 W Main St Avon, CT 06001
For Sale
This exceptional investment opportunity presents a net-leased Mobil gas station and convenience store in Avon, CT. The property boasts a prime location at a signalized four-way intersection on Route 44 and Route 167, benefiting from high daily traffic counts exceeding 35,000 and 14,000 vehicles respectively. The 880 square foot building sits on a 0.43-acre lot within Avon's central retail corridor, surrounded by major retailers such as CVS, Walgreens, Stop & Shop, and Marshalls, and near shopping destinations like Avon Marketplace and Simsbury Commons. The property features a strong 5.85% cap rate and a substantial net operating income (NOI) of $175,450. The current lease, with Mobil (leased to Global Partners LP, a Fortune 500 company with over $17 billion in revenue), has 7.9 years remaining on the initial 20-year term, followed by eight five-year renewal options, each with a 10% rent increase. Avon's affluent demographics, with average household incomes exceeding $160,000, further enhance the investment's appeal. This is a rare opportunity to acquire a stable, high-performing retail asset in a thriving Connecticut market. The asking price is $2,999,000, representing a price per square foot of $3,407.95. The lease commenced October 1, 2021, and expires October 1, 2032. This NNN lease structure minimizes landlord responsibilities, offering a passive income stream with significant long-term potential.
